Colorado Payroll Employment By County for The Private Mining Quarrying And Oil And Gas Extraction Industry in May, 2023
Updated on January 7, 2024.

According to recent data from the US Bureau of Labor Statistics, in May, 2023, Colorado added 91 number of jobs to the private mining, quarrying, and oil and gas extraction industry. Among Colorado counties, Larimer added the highest number of jobs (66), followed by Morgan (11), and Arapahoe (9).
